Ingredients and substitutions
- Butter – use olive oil for a lighter option.
- Yellow onion – white onion or shallots would also be good.
- Celery – swap out for carrots or another vegetable of your choice.
- Carrot – use another vegetable or leave it out.
- Garlic – freshly minced garlic is best but jarred minced garlic will work in a pinch.
- Flour – gluten-free flour or cornstarch will also help thicken the soup.
- Milk – use any non-sweetened, plant-based milk of your choice. Extra broth will also work.
- Chicken broth – vegetable broth is the best substitute here.
- Broccoli – this is pretty essential to the recipe. Use fresh or frozen broccoli.
- Cheddar cheese – sharp cheddar, fontina, Gruyere and Swiss are all great options.

Frequently asked questions
How many calories are in a bowl of broccoli cheddar soup from Panera?
One serving of the original broccoli cheddar soup from Panera Bread has 360 calories. In comparison, my recipe shaves off the calories by using lighter ingredients, with only 244 calories per serving.
Why is my soup gritty?
If you find that your soup is gritty, the cheese likely didn't melt properly. Make sure you whisk the cheese in the soup until it's fully melted and combined before serving.
How can I make the soup healthier?
To make a lighter version of the soup, use low-fat milk or half-and-half instead of heavy cream. Incorporating more vegetables, such as cauliflower or spinach will add nutrients and fiber. Reducing the amount of cheese or using a reduced-fat variety can also decrease the calorie content.

How to store and reheat
Store: Let the soup cool to room temperature, then refrigerate in airtight containers for up to 5 days.
Reheat: Warm on the stovetop over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until heated through.
Freeze & Reheat: Allow the soup to cool completely, then freeze in airtight containers for up to 3 months. Thaw overnight in the refrigerator, then reheat on the stovetop as above.

Copycat Panera Broccoli Cheddar Soup
Ingredients
- 2 tbsp butter
- 1 yellow onion, diced
- 2 stalks celery, diced
- 1 carrot, diced
- 2 cloves garlic, minced `
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/4 tsp pepper
- 1/4 cup flour
- 1 cup milk
- 2 cups chicken broth
- 1 head broccoli, finely chopped
- 1 1/2 cups cheddar cheese, grated
Instructions
- Heat butter in a large pot over med-high heat. Add onion, celery and carrot, sauteing for 5 minutes until veggies are tender.
- Add in garlic and salt & pepper, stirring for 30 seconds. Whisk in flour, tossing veggies to coat, then slowly whisk in milk and chicken broth.
- Bring to a boil, then add broccoli. Allow soup to cook for 8-10 minutes until broccoli is tender, stirring often.
- Remove from heat, then whisk in cheese until fully melted and combined. Serve and enjoy!
